I am somewhat familiar with the regedit config of prefetch options, but I
was wondering if there was a way to list specific apps XP could prefetch,
whilst limiting XP prefetching others. Say, allow XP to prefetch Boot
sequence, Word, Excel, Visio (used multiple times per day), but not
Publisher or Access (rarely used), as an example?

Regedit options:
a.. 0-Disable
b.. 1-Application Launch Prefetch
c.. 2-Boot Prefetch
d.. 3-Prefetch everything

Add the /prefetch:1 switch to the end of the shortcut target.

I.e. "C:\Program Files\Microsoft Office\Office10\WINWORD.EXE" /prefetch:1
or "C:\Program Files\Microsoft Money\System\MSMONEY.EXE" /prefetch:1

Doesn't work with notepad.exe.
